
Soft air fryer cheese bread with garlic, herbs, and melty cheese for an easy savory breakfast or quick side.
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 20–22 minutes
Total Time: 30–35 minutes
Servings: 8 slices
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1 tbsp sugar
2 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t
1 tsp garlic powder
2 large eggs
3/4 cup milk
1/4 cup melted butter
1 cup shredded mozzarella
1/2 cup shredded cheddar
1 tbsp chopped parsley
2 tbsp grated parmesan for topping (optional)
1. Preheat the air fryer to 320°F and lightly grease a small loaf pan or baking dish that fits inside your basket.
2.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, salt, and garlic powder.
3. In a second bowl, whisk the eggs, milk, and melted butter until smooth.
4. Pour the wet mixture into the dry ingredients and stir just until combined. Fold in the mozzarella, cheddar, and parsley.
5. Transfer the batter to the prepared pan and smooth the top. Sprinkle with parmesan if using.
6. Air fry for 20–22 minutes, or until the top is golden and a toothpick comes out mostly clean.
7. If the top browns too quickly, loosely cover with foil after about 12–14 minutes.
8. Let the bread cool for 10 minutes before slicing and serving.
Do not overmix the batter, or the bread can turn dense.
Fill the pan no more than about 2/3 full.
Loosely tent with foil if the top gets too dark before the center is done.
Let the loaf rest before slicing so the crumb sets properly.
Swap the cheddar for Monterey Jack or pepper jack for a different flavor.
Add chopped cooked bacon or green onions for a savory breakfast version.
Use Italian seasoning instead of parsley for a more herby loaf.
